The Importance of Charity in our Society

Extreme poverty also is a feature of one of the richest and most powerful nations in the world, the USA. Findings have documented homelessness, unsafe sanitation and sewage disposal practices, as well as police surveillance, criminalization, and harassment of the poor. The rise in poverty, they found, disproportionately affects people of all cast and creed. The report concluded that the pervasiveness of poverty and inequality are shockingly at odds with the United States immense wealth and its founding commitment to human rights.
